What is a ‘mom influencer?’

Mom influencers are some of the web’s most relatable content creators. Momfluencers can be any age and produce content catered to other moms (or dads) at any stage of the parenting journey. 

Since anyone can be a mom, there is truly no limit to the types of companies that can find success partnering with momfluencers. Those who find the right brand-aligned creators to insert into their marketing mix gain access to a devoted audience that looks to their favorite creators for parenting inspiration and honest product endorsements.

Brands with successful mommy influencer partnerships

Crayola

Crayola regularly partners with nano and micro influencers to showcase its products and picks the highest performers for ongoing partnerships. The brand’s most recent collaboration is with mother-daughter duo CJ and Cori. The creator team currently publishes branded content every Tuesday and Thursday to promote Crayola products and prove how much fun families can have with arts and crafts time.

SlumberPod

SlumberPod started its influencer marketing program to help promote its baby sleep canopies for parents on the go. Since starting the program, SlumberPod has grown its Instagram following to nearly 70K and generated more than seven figures from its creator collaborations. The brand’s most successful content involves giveaways and tutorials for its innovative product lines. 

“We do very little paid marketing because we are getting so much revenue just from the influencer program.”

Mallory Whitmore, marketing manager at SlumberPod

Tubby Todd makes natural soap products safe for babies and their delicate skin. The brand has plenty of fans raving about its products online, which leaves plenty of opportunities to source user-generated content from creators who already love its products. Tubby Todd also has a “mama group” to help foster relationships, share educational tips, and get its community excited to continue promoting the brand.
